Fix T63252: Bind in Mesh Deform Modifier fails
A regression since 64c8d72ef1ad. The solution is to force modifier evaluation for an evaluated object, and let it to copy binding data back to original when is being evaluated for binding. Reviewers: brecht Reviewed By: brecht Differential Revision: https://developer.blender.org/D4642
